You could always try to find a packet of Strand cigarettes.

25jdv2a.jpg

It was one of the most catastrophic advertising campaigns of the late 50's. The advertisement showed a man alone lighting up on a street corner – the slogan was 'You're never alone with a Strand'

But people got the idea that here was a cigarette for Billy No-Mates. Sales were awful and the cigarette brand was rapidly withdrawn.
